Mounds View City Council February 26, 2007 <br />Regular Meeting Page 15 <br />• Mayor Marty indicated that they also discussed MSA funds and how to free those up and he <br />brought up trailways and she said her office could be helpful in finding and applying for grants. <br />Mayor Marty indicated that he spoke with Ms. McCullum's Minnesota Staff about information <br />about the soundwall and the big thing is that everybody realizes that Minnesota is far behind <br />other states as far as transportation goes. <br />Mayor Marty indicated that he brought up Bus Route 860 and how the Met Council decided to <br />pull the route and that Ieft a lot of people with no transportation. He then said it was a good <br />meeting and everyone was right to the point and the next morning there was a transportation <br />meeting and the representative and senator there were trying to promote the gas taa~ of 10 cents <br />per gallon and he was against that but after hearing the discussion and the arguments the last gas <br />tax that Minnesota put through was in 1988. <br />Mayor Marty noted that the state of Wisconsin has slightly more expensive gas but they have <br />funds available for working on the roads. <br />Council Member Mueller said that the Community Center Garage Sale was Saturday and the <br />proceeds benefited the YMCA and the Community Center. Items left over will be donated to <br />other charitable groups and she would like to thank those that participated in the sale either by <br />donation or by shopping at the sale. <br />• Mayor Marty noted that the money goes toward scholarships for kids within the Communi that <br />tY <br />cannot afford to participate in activities. <br />Council Member Flaherty indicated the Home show was going on in Blaine and some staff <br />members were at the Mounds View booth to promote Mounds View. <br />B.
